XMReality Second Quarter 2024 Earnings: kr0.08 loss per share (vs kr0.10 loss in 2Q 2023)
XMReality (STO:XMR) Second Quarter 2024 Results
Key Financial Results
- Revenue: kr6.65m (down 11% from 2Q 2023).
- Net loss: kr8.11m (loss narrowed by 14% from 2Q 2023).
- kr0.08 loss per share (improved from kr0.10 loss in 2Q 2023).

XMReality Earnings Insights
Looking ahead, revenue is forecast to grow 36% p.a. on average during the next 3 years, compared to a 16% growth forecast for the Software industry in Sweden.
